Uploaded image for project: 'PUBLIC - Liferay Social Office Community Edition'
  1. PUBLIC - Liferay Social Office Community Edition
  2. SOS-2038

Private Messaging Portlet autocomplete does not include users with inherited roles


    • Branch Version/s:
      6.2.x, 6.1.x
    • Backported to Branch:
    • Affects Portal Version/s:
      6.2.0 CE GA1, 6.2.10 EE GA1, 6.1.30 EE GA3, 6.1.20 EE GA2


      Issue: When creating a new message in the Private Messaging portlet, the autocomplete "to" only lists users who have the SO User role directly. It does not list those who inherit the role.
      Steps to Reproduce:

      1. Deploy SO.
      2. Create a test user: test2.
      3. Create a user group "SO Users" and make test2 a member.
      4. In SO Configurations under the Users tab, add Test Test and select save.
      5. In SO Configurations under the User Groups tab, add the User Group SO Users and select save.
      6. Add private messaging portlet to the page.
      7. In SO navigate to Dashboard > Message > 'New Message'
      8. Click the "to" field.

      Expected Result: The drop-down list of suggestions includes Test Test and Test 2
      Actual Result: The drop-down list of suggestions includes only Test Test. It does not list test2.

      (Same behavior can be found with organizations by adding users to them and adding the organization in SO Configuration.)


          Issue Links



              • Votes:
                0 Vote for this issue
                1 Start watching this issue


                • Created:
                  Days since last comment:
                  6 years, 36 weeks ago


                  Version Package
                  3.0 EE GA1
                  3.0 CE GA1